|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Oven not heating | Power supply issue | Check power connection and circuit breaker. |
| Uneven cooking | Improper rack placement | Adjust rack position for even heat distribution. |
| Timer not working | Settings issue | Reset the timer and try again. |
| Door not closing | Obstruction | Check for any items blocking the door. |
